A Data Analyst Supply Chain leverages technical abilities to synthesize complex analytical tasks into easily understood data-driven stories. Responsible for working collaboratively with other analysts to apply established analytical processes on diverse datasets to deduce insights and solve real-world business problems. Also ensures that all reporting and analytical responsibilities are completed competently in a timely manner, continually seeking out opportunities to hone existing technical skills (e.g. writing SQL/code, statistics, machine learning, etc.) and learn new skills. Operates under the supervision and mentorship of more experienced managers and data scientists.
Key Responsibilities
30% Executes existing reporting and analytical responsibilities
20% Leverages data analytics tools to create new dashboards, reports, and any additional ad-hoc requests
20% Ensures the quality of work output by displaying a keen attention to detail
20% Develops additional technical competencies and subject matter expertise within core functional group
10% Presents findings in easily understood ways, focuses on how the data analytics fits into the bigger picture
